In the Ghana Hemoglobin Meter Market, some challenges faced include limited access to healthcare facilities in rural areas, leading to low awareness and adoption of hemoglobin meters. Additionally, affordability is a significant barrier for many individuals who may not be able to purchase the devices due to financial constraints. There is also a lack of trained healthcare professionals who can effectively utilize hemoglobin meters, resulting in underutilization of the technology. Furthermore, unreliable power supply in certain regions can hinder the consistent use of these devices. Addressing these challenges would require targeted efforts to improve healthcare infrastructure, increase affordability, provide training to healthcare workers, and ensure reliable access to electricity for optimal use of hemoglobin meters in Ghana.

The Ghanaian government has implemented various policies to regulate the Hemoglobin Meter Market in the country. One key policy is the requirement for all Hemoglobin Meters to be registered with the Food and Drugs Authority (FDA) to ensure quality and safety standards are met. Additionally, there are guidelines in place to restrict the importation of substandard or counterfeit Hemoglobin Meters to protect consumers. The government also collaborates with healthcare providers and organizations to promote the use of Hemoglobin Meters in screening and managing anemia, particularly among vulnerable populations such as pregnant women and children. These policies aim to ensure that accurate and reliable Hemoglobin Meters are available in the market to support effective healthcare interventions and improve health outcomes for the Ghanaian population.
